The current amount of Supply (i.e. Capacity) at Dallas is 30. Suppose there is an opportunity to outsource additional capacity at this location. The question is how much additional capacity should we target? For example, should we double capacity to 60, triple it to 90, or choose some other level? To answer this question, you will solve a series of transportation problems inside a VBA loop with the Dallas capacity varied from 30 to 90 in steps of 10, i.e.30,40,50,...90.
